  Power of the Daleks was Patrick Troughton's first story as the rejuvenated Doctor, and he underplays his role, letting the audience wonder like Ben and Polly whether this man is really The Doctor as we knew him ...

  None of this story survives. It happens to have a fine supporting cast. If we check IMDB and look for the cast's appearances around this time, in shows that have had a good life on video, we get a few leads. In a moment, we'll be following those leads ...

Robert James, who played Dalek-loving mad scientist Lesterson in The Power of the Daleks, also appeared in The Avengers, five times.

HIs first appearance was in "Hot Snow," the first ever Avengers episode, which is now missing apart from the first act, which survives in great quality. As far as I can tell, you only hear Robert James in the existing footage. He had a much larger part in the next episode, but that episode is missing.

So, let's go on to:
"The Avengers" Death a La Carte - 21 December 1963 (Season 3, Episode 13)





Robert James plays the main villain in this episode (spoiler alert), which involves a Middle Eastern ruler and expensive poisoned food.

This being a season 3 episode with Cathy Gale, this was shot on video and the quality of the episode on the DVD is poor. Still, Robert James gets plenty of good screentime.

Pamela Ann Davy played Janley, assistant to Lesterson, in Power of the Daleks.

Here's Pamela Ann Davy in "The Avengers" - The Living Dead - 22 February 1967 (Season 5, Episode 7)





My copy of this episode isn't very high quality, and Ms. Davy spends much of her screentime being rather odd, so this isn't absolutely the best reference I could have come up with, but it should still be very helpful for this character.

At first seeming quirky and harmless, she turns out to be a baddie under the employ of Julian Glover. I didn't actually watch the episode, but I gathered that much from the visuals.

Robert James appears in "The Avengers" Look - (Stop Me If You've Heard This One) But There Were These Two Fellers...  8 May 1968 (Season 7, Episode 11)  ...

.... credited as "Merlin," it's probably a small role and I didn't go looking for it. [I've had a copy on VHS somewhere for 15 years ....]

What I looked up next was ...

Robert James in "The Avengers" - Too Many Christmas Trees - 25 December 1965 (Season 4, Episode 13)







Not a large part - he plays an evil butler called Jenkins. This is a Diana Rigg episode and therefore nicely shot on film. If he has more closeups in this I missed them. The episode is about psychic powers and murder at a Dickensian Christmas party.

Power of the Daleks dates to November-December 1966. Eight years later, his hair having turned grey, Robert James appeared in a popular sitcom ....

Robert James in "Steptoe and Son" - Upstairs, Downstairs, Upstairs, Downstairs -  20 October 1974 (Season 8, Episode 5)







He plays a doctor, advising Harry H. Corbett that Wilfrid Brambell needs to be bedridden, due to his bad back. Predictably, Brambell takes advantage of the situation, to get his son to serve his every whim.

Robert James appears in the beginning of the episode, and is mostly shown reacting to Corbett.
